I'd like to share Rocky's wisdom and here is an extract of the film's dialogues. It's just before Rocky starts to fight again.
"The world ain't all sunshine and rainbows.
It's a very rough, mean place... and no matter how tough you think you are, it'll always bring you to your knees and keep you there, permanently... if you let it.
You or nobody ain't never gonna hit as hard as life.
But it ain't about how hard you hit... it's about how hard you can get hit, and keep moving forward... how much you can take, and keep moving forward.
If you know what you're worth, go out and get what you're worth.
But you gotta be willing to take the hit."
